At present, the existing coal technologies under development, coal mining, processing and utilizationof environmental pollution caused by a series of problems, such as dust, solid waste, waste water, groundsubsidence, etc., to the atmosphere, water and the surrounding environment causing serious pollution,conventional coal environmental monitoring methods have been unable to meet demand. To be able todetect contamination and to take effective measures to prevent the spread of pollution and intensifiedShenhua Geological Exploration Co., Ltd.(later referred to as Shenhua company) decided to developM-SRSM-S (mine satellite remote sensing regular operation system), all-time, weather, dynamicmonitoring of large-scale coal environment and achieve operational environmental monitoring system. Theauthor is responsible for the entire process including research data management subsystem.Data management subsystem is a subsystem of the entire mining operation of satellite remote sensingmonitoring of operational systems, and its main function is through both manual and automatic mode, theimage data to an external data storage, and data services for the regular operation of the system ofproduction and data storage. In developing the system implementation process, the main application oftechnical data verification, concurrent data access control, message-based communication TCP/IPprotocol, unified data access interface, and remote sensing image data storage.The main work are: Firstly,fully understand and analyze user needs, based on the completion of theoverall design of the mine operational satellite remote sensing monitoring system data managementsubsystem running. Secondly, based on the needs of the user data, research and design data validation processes, concurrent data access control policy and message communication, to achieve access to imagedata. Thirdly, the data requirements for the system in the business of the production process, through aunified data access interface that provides uniform access to data services for the entire business of runningthe system. Fourth, According to the characteristics of HJ satellite remote sensing data, combined with theOracle relational database design and implementation of remote sensing image data stored in Oracle.Data management subsystem for the mining operations of satellite remote sensing monitoring systemprovides a good run data services, in the actual production environment, mining operational satelliteremote sensing monitoring system is running well, completed the pre-production targets, and increaseproductivity.
